Output e643e7d9068fca26708e1ff43b9bfdc019bcd34f75defe1d2c42abd41c4ae5aa:0

value
4421622904
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8337de5c3c6ddecdc3334a6ac5ba08629cc20821 OP_EQUALVERIFY OP_CHECKSIG
address
1CxpSwySXt18A3fbR4Dk4oKPRNGimdVmz1
transaction
e643e7d9068fca26708e1ff43b9bfdc019bcd34f75defe1d2c42abd41c4ae5aa
confirmations
601589
spent
true